The Evertz 500ADA-EQ is an analog video distribution amplifier card designed for use within the Evertz 500FR frame. It features an equalizing input and nine outputs, making it suitable for distributing a variety of analog video signals, including those with frequencies up to 30MHz and amplitudes up to 2.5V p-p. 

View Product Features

  • Equalizing Input : The 500ADA-EQ includes an input that can compensate for signal degradation over cable length, ensuring a cleaner signal at the outputs.
  • Nine Outputs : It provides nine individual outputs, allowing for the distribution of the signal to multiple destinations.
  • Signal Compatibility : The card is designed to handle a wide range of analog video signals, including pulses and other signals up to 2V p-p.
  • User Selectable Low Pass Filter : A user-selectable low-pass filter with an 8MHz corner frequency can be used to eliminate unwanted high frequencies from the signal.
  • Hot Swappable : The card is hot-swappable, meaning it can be inserted or removed from the 500FR frame without needing to power down the system.
  • Front Panel LEDs : Two LEDs on the front of the module indicate the health of the module, with one indicating a local fault and the other indicating overall module health.
